Basic facts about this digital color

In the Register's classification, #B68F7C belongs to the Orange Color Family, featuring Mild Saturation and Very Light brightness. In numbers: rgb(182, 143, 124) (71.4% red, 56.1% green, 48.6% blue), or CMYK 0 / 15 / 23 / 29 for print. New to color codes? See our guide to RGB color codes.

A softly balanced amber-leaning orange, #B68F7C appears airy and pastel-like. Designers typically reach for tones like this for clean interfaces where content needs room to breathe. In The Official Register of Color Names it is practically indistinguishable from Autumn Beige (#AF8D7A). Its next-closest registered neighbors are Aesthetic Brown (#B6977D) and Sandrift (#AF937D).

In RGB terms — rgb(182, 143, 124) — the red channel does the heavy lifting here. If you plan to put text on a #B68F7C background, choose black — the contrast ratio is 7.2:1 (passing WCAG AAA), while white manages only 2.9:1. #B68F7C color harmonies

Color harmonies are pleasing color schemes created according to their position on a color wheel.

Complementary

Complementary color schemes are made by picking two opposite colors con the color wheel. They appear vibrant near to each other.

Complementary color schemes

Split complementary

Split complementary schemes are like complementary but they uses two adiacent colors of the complement. They are more flexible than complementary ones.

Split complementary color scheme

Analogous

Analogous color schemes are made by picking three colors that are next to each other on the color wheel. They are perceived as calm and serene.

Analogous color scheme

Triadic

Triadic color schemes are created by picking three colors equally spaced on the color wheel. They appear quite contrasted and multicolored.

Triadic color scheme

Tetradic

Tetradic color schemes are made form two couples of complementary colors in a rectangular shape on the color wheel.

Tetradic color scheme

Square

Square color schemes are like tetradic arranged in a square instead of rectangle. Colors appear even more contrasting.
